For example float func(float num) { return num * 0.5; } warning: implicit conversion from 'float' to 'double' to match other operan= d of binary expression [-Wdouble-promotion] 3 | return num * 0.5; However, GCC does not actually use the double representation for this liter= al (and others than can be represented equally in float as in double). The assembler output for both "0.5" and "0.5f" is the same: func(float): push rbp mov rbp, rsp movss DWORD PTR [rbp-4], xmm0 movss xmm1, DWORD PTR [rbp-4] movss xmm0, DWORD PTR .LC0[rip] mulss xmm0, xmm1 pop rbp ret .LC0: .long 1056964608 This warning is misleading and should not be emitted=
